What does an Encompass Health Quality Risk Director do?
Career: Encompass Health Quality Risk Director
An Encompass Health Quality Risk Director is responsible for overseeing and managing quality improvement and risk management programs within the healthcare organization. They develop and implement policies to ensure patient safety, regulatory compliance, and high standards of care. This role involves analyzing data to identify areas for improvement, coordinating training for staff, and ensuring that the facility meets all federal and state healthcare regulations. The Quality Risk Director also leads investigations into incidents and works to minimize risks to patients and staff.
